使用 Node.js 将 Word 文档渲染为网页

Word 文档呈现为 Web 内容对于许多现代应用程序至关重要,尤其是在可访问性和跨平台兼容性至关重要的情况下。如果您希望使用 Node.js 将 Word 文档渲染为网页,那么有一种有效的方法可以利用基于 Java 的后端,同时实现与 Node.js 环境的无缝集成。此方法可确保将 DOCX 内容准确地转换为浏览器可读的网页,而无需依赖 Microsoft Office 或第三方转换器。无论您是构建在线文档查看器、CMS 还是内部仪表板工具,这种Word 到网页渲染 Node.js 方法都能帮助您提供高质量、浏览器可读的输出。

使用 Node.js 将 Word 文档渲染为网页的步骤

  1. 首先设置 通过 Java 实现 Node.js 的 GroupDocs.Viewer 以启用 Word 文档到网页的渲染
  2. 将 groupdocs.viewer 包导入到您的 Node.js 应用程序中
  3. 使用 HtmlViewOptions.forEmbeddedResources 配置网页输出,以确保样式和媒体嵌入到结果页面中
  4. 初始化 Viewer 类并提供 DOCX 文件路径以准备处理
  5. 使用您配置的选项执行 Viewer.view 方法将 DOCX 文档转换为网页

要使用 Node.js 从 DOCX 生成网页,首先需要使用 groupdocs.viewer 包安装专用渲染库。接下来,使用 HtmlViewOptions.forEmbeddedResources 配置网页输出设置,该库会生成独立的网页。这些文件包含所有必要的资源,例如字体和图片,使其易于在任何浏览器中使用。通过创建一个新的 Viewer 实例并调用 view() 方法来加载 DOCX 文件,以处理并将其转换为网页。完成后,应关闭 Viewer 以释放系统内存。此解决方案针对快速渲染、清晰的输出和跨设备的用户友好体验进行了优化。

使用 Node.js 将 Word 文档渲染到网页的代码

将此功能集成到您的应用程序中,用户即可使用 Node.js 在浏览器中显示 Word 文件,无需插件或下载。此方法可确保每个细节(包括布局和嵌入媒体)都得到保留并准确呈现。凭借其高效的后端处理和 Node.js 兼容性,它非常适合需要可扩展文档处理的 Web 应用程序。它简化了部署,增强了用户体验,并减少了对客户端软件的依赖。开发人员可以专注于构建直观的界面,而此渲染工具则负责处理格式转换的复杂性。对于任何寻求基于浏览器的高质量文档预览解决方案的团队来说,此方法都提供了强大且简化的实施路径。

之前,我们演示了如何使用 Node.js 将 Word 文档转换为图像格式。如果您想深入了解或希望提升您的实现能力,我们建议您探索我们的完整教程 使用 Node.js 将 Word 文档渲染为图像

 简体中文